This ultra high-performance motorcycle tire has been engineered to meet the demands of a track day session. It has an exceptionally quick warm-up time and Continental's zero-degree steel belt spooled onto a rayon base that delivers the highest possible levels of grip, high-speed stability, and control. The 120/70-17 & 190/55-17 sizes are OE replacements for BMW’s new S1000RR.

Comments about Continental Conti Sport Attack Hypersport Motorcycle Tire:
This is the 3rd set of tires to go on my 08 ZZR 600 and I must say the best I have had. The first set was the sportmax the bike came with then I went to the Dunlop D616. These have much more grip than both those tires combined. I'm a daily driver and my route to work takes me over mountains and nothing but hairpin curves so grip is essential. The tire tread is cool looking. (I know that has nothing to do with how good the tire is but bare with me). Its looks to get its design from the way more pricy race tires due to the fact it has deep tread in the center but on the outer sides of the tread its almost completely slick. I haven't had the pleasure (not really a pleasure in my mind) of seeing how it handles in the rain so my review is lacking that aspect. Anyway I hope this review was helpful to you future owners of this tire.

As a set of replacement tires for Dunlop 208 Quals I had on my 06 Busa, the Conti Sport Attacks surpasses them in some areas. I have put about 1K miles on the set and I can feel when riding better road feed back, quicker turn-ins and lean grip. The busa seems to handle now like a lighter bike. On the negative side there is a little more shimmy, and less a feeling of control then with the Dunlops. At high speeds it depends on how good the road surface is. At speeds over a 100mph, that feeling of smooth control was not as strong, but the road feedback was excellent. Still I'm glad I have them on the bike.

Bluntly stated, there are better full-on sport tires. But if you ride on the public roads more than the racetrack, then this tire is hard to beat! What it sacrifices in all-out traction it makes up for in better wear characteristics, wet-weather manners and handling! And the difference in grip between this tire and the competition is minimal. The only flaw I've seen with the tire is that it can get a bit greasy if ridden on a track at stupid-fast speeds by the end of the session on a really hot day.
